North Peak
turn-by-turn mileage log


Mile 0.0 - Start up the fireroad under the trees. This is Old San Pedro Mountain Road.
Mile 0.24 - At the Y in front of the ranger's house, turn left. The trail now becomes really old blacktop with a lot of holes in it.
Mile 2.36 - At the Y, go right and start climbing the dirt, steep fireroad called North Peak Access Road.
Mile 2.57 - Very steep climb starts. Granny gear!
Mile 4.57 - At the T in front of the first radio antennas, turn right.
Mile 4.69 - Cross the fireroad and climb up through the S-turn.
Mile 4.77 - Cross open area to the right of the second radio antennas. Go onto singletrack.
Mile 4.79 - Top of North Peak. 1888 feet. Look around. Turn around and head back down.
Mile 4.90 - Cross the fireroad and continue downhill.
Mile 5.02 - At the Y, go right and climb up to the first radio antennas.
Mile 5.16 - Radio antennas. Turn around.
Mile 5.21 - Turn right on the singletrack. Now, this is a rocky, technical piece of singletrack. If you don't want to do it, just continue back down on the fireroad.
Mile 5.30 - Turn right on North Peak Access Road. All downhill from here.
Mile 7.10 - You can take the brown singletrack on the right if you want.
Has quite a little drop at the end of it back to the fireroad.
Mile 7.21 - Singletrack appears on the right right past where the brown singletrack comes back in. Continue on North Peak Access Road and get ready to take the singletrack on coming up on the right.
Mile 7.22 - Turn slightly right onto the singletrack and take it over the hill. At the end of this singletrack, it splits three ways. The far right is the easiest.
Mile 7.32 - Turn left on the paved road.
Mile 7.36 - Turn right on Old San Pedro Mountain Road.
Mile 7.38 - Turn left on the singletrack.
Mile 7.45 - Turn left on Old San Pedro Mountain Road.
Mile 8.04 - At the Y, continue to the right on Old San Pedro Mountain Road.
Mile 9.47 - At the ranger's house, turn right.
Mile 9.71 - End of ride.
